Ship degaussing winding adjustment is an important aspect of degaussing work.In order to improve the compensation quality and operational efficiency of the degaussing winding for ships'mag-netic fields,an optimization algorithm was proposed for this purpose.The algorithm took into account the compensation characteristics of different windings,established the optimization objectives and constraints for ship degaussing winding adjustment,and enhanced the effectiveness of the algorithm by incorporating adaptive genetic algorithms.Experimental results demonstrate that the proposed al-gorithm achieves significant optimization effects and robustness,greatly enhancing the precision and speed of degaussing winding adjustment.It can serve as a computer algorithm replacement for this work and provide reliable support for the intelligent ship degaussing.
